try also to take photos of the motherboard and place the measured voltages of the coils, also the 19v rails. maybe you are missing a 19volts rails. do a resistance check from ground to any coil that you can access make sure there is no short circuit I mean is dead short. sometimes 1 ohm or 5 ohms is ok it depends on the board design.Last edited by Duranitron; 04-30-2025, 12:45 AM.

Hello, when it starts does it continues to run? or it hangs or turn off? try to run the unit with adapter inserted and with battery only, try to use known good adapter. If you can access the motherboard try to measure the always on voltage usually its a 5v or 3.3volts that is always on. it waits for the turn on button to be press to wake the unit. any beep code or cpu fan spin? try also to swap good ddr memory or clean the pins, try to measure the voltage on all coils that you can find in the board and post it here, do this at your own risk....

Fujitsu Lifebook AH53/X Need Schematics or boardview
Fujitsu Lifebook AH53/X FMVA53XBKS
Specs: Intel i7 processor, 8Gb ddr4 memory module, 250Gb SSD,
date stamp is 2016
Motherboard model: ADZAM-6050A2761701-MB-A01
Symptoms: Sometimes the unit will turn on made it to the windows login screen then turns off, most of the time the Unit can be turn on but only the power on is lit and will eventually turn of in less than 30 seconds, CPU fan spins, no beep code and no display.🤕🤕🤕
Basics: replaced known good 19v adapter, replaced known good ddr4 memory module, test the always on voltage 5v, 3.3v all...

So Bios is ok. 5v and 3.3v rail ok..and you can turn on and off the laptop with all the main voltage present. the processor warm up when on. The only problem is the display is blank, no video on external monitor. visual inspection first top and botton of the mobo and then try to run the system with bare minimum. try to power the motherboard only and place an external monitor to isolate it from the rest. try to boot it. make sure to place the heatsink and fan as AMD is known to heat up fast. Maybe an attachment is malfunctioning.. the LVDS cable is shorting or maybe the battery or wifi card. a...

Thanks for the reply. I already turned on the unit by shorting the pin 25 of the keyboard connector.. only the 5v and 3v coil voltage is not present. There is no short in the 3.3v rail but I measure 1 ohm resistance from coil to ground. I remove the soldered joint that connect the 3.3v rail to the 3.3v coil to isolate the 3.3v supply to the circuit. The 3.3v power supply is rated at about 10 to 30A , I think the problem is in the 3.3v supply. Removed the shorted mosfet PQ8703 and replaced it with new again.. power it up.. then the mosfet PQ8702 shorts but not he PQ8703.. Investigating if this...
